当前位置: 首页 > news >正文

类似千图网的素材网站网站页面架构怎么写

类似千图网的素材网站,网站页面架构怎么写,四网合一网站建设,2024年瘟疫大爆发1. init 代码块的顺序问题 init代码块和成员变量实质上是按先后顺序执行的。若果init{} 中有成员变量使用。要把成员变量放到代码块之前。 2. init代码块之中的函数问题 下面是一段错误的代码#xff1a; class mkotlin{val info:Stringinit {getInfoMethod()info adad… 1. init 代码块的顺序问题 init代码块和成员变量实质上是按先后顺序执行的。若果init{} 中有成员变量使用。要把成员变量放到代码块之前。 2. init代码块之中的函数问题 下面是一段错误的代码 class mkotlin{val info:Stringinit {getInfoMethod()info adaddddd}fun getInfoMethod() println(info 的值 ${info}) } fun main(){mkotlin().getInfoMethod()} 错误原因 mkotlin().getInfoMethod() 中的第一个括号 调用mkotlin的主构造函数。 主构造函数会先调用init代码块。此时getInfoMethod() 先于info初始化。 3. 初始化陷阱 下面是一段会崩溃的代码。无法取得.length()的值的。 class mkotlin(_info :String){val content:String getInfoMethod()private val info:String _infoprivate fun getInfoMethod() info } fun main(){println(长度 ${mkotlin(changdu).content.length})} 问题的原因 1.mkotlin(changdu) 调用主构造函数 2. content访问getInfoMethod 方法获取info。----》info还没有来的及初始化无法确保info一定会有值 所以info放到最前面。  所有类成员都放到最前面去
http://www.pierceye.com/news/283016/

相关文章:

  • 昆明建站网址dw怎么做秋季运动会网站
  • 为什么要建设个人网站在建工程
  • o2o网站设计方案做一个网站只做前端怎么做
  • 长沙网站建设公司联系方式网站注册手机号安全吗
  • 广州市网站建设服务机构建设部网站查资质
  • 医院网站建设思路wordpress mx主题
  • 天津如何做百度的网站虚拟机做局域网网站服务器
  • 网站建设维护需要懂哪些知识网站建设优质公司
  • 怎么做网络彩票网站校园网站建设经费申请报告
  • 廊坊公司做网站一般网站图标是用什么做的
  • php网站开发文档模板玖壹购网站是做啥子的
  • 海报模板网站有哪些小程序电商平台排名
  • 百度一下百度网站苏州优秀网站设计企业
  • 通信管理局网站备案cms网站建设的实训总结
  • 西安知名网站建设公司百度网页版微信
  • 单纯python能完成网站开发吗门户网站衰落的原因
  • 唐山微网站建设价格宁波外贸网站推广优化
  • 如何能把网站做的更大赤峰网站建设赤峰
  • 织梦大气绿色大气农业能源化工机械产品企业网站源码模版网站设计是用ps做图吗
  • 长沙建设网站公司浙江网站建设上市公司
  • 成都艾邦视觉专业网站建设公司有内涵大气的公司名字
  • 制作学校网站编程基础知识大全
  • 建设银行网站买手机阿里云已备案域名购买
  • 12个优秀的平面设计素材网站wordpress 标题 拼音
  • 瑶海区网站建设公司上海app开发定制公司
  • 北海建设厅网站局域网的电脑怎么做网站服务器
  • 莱芜网站建设价格域名注册成功后怎么使用网站
  • 衡阳县建设局网站wordpress 图片缓存
  • 浙江门户网站建设公司新闻稿发布
  • 温州网站建设排名wordpress 汉化失败